#e388d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e388d0 is composed of 89% red, 53.3%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.1% magenta, 8.4%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 312.5 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 71.2%. #e388d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c711a1.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

● #e388d0 color description : Very soft magenta.
#e388d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e388d0 has RGB values of R:227, G:136,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.08,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14911696.
